Testosterone, nandrolone, and oxymetholone were
the most commonly consumed AASs during the last cycle
and an average of 2-3 AASs were used during each cycle
(“stacking”). Participants completed an Aggression Rating
Scale to assess current feelings of anger and hostility and
were presented with a modified Stroop Color Word Conflict
Task containing sets of neutral (e.g., shelves, broom),
verbally aggressive (e.g., hostile, ridicule), and physically
aggressive (e.g., attack, violence) words. Current AAS users
rated themselves more impatient (p< 0.10) and belligerent
(p< 0.10) than past users and took longer than past users and
nonusers to name the colors of all word sets, but there were
no significant differences between word sets
